Match details

Premier League

Craven Cottage | 09 May 2011 at 20:00 UK local time

Fulham 2 - 5 Liverpool

Notes

  • - Jamie Carragher moves past Emlyn Hughes and Ray Clemence on to 666 first-team competitive appearances for the club, meaning that only Ian Callaghan (857) is above him now.

    - Dirk Kuyt scores for the fifth consecutive Premier League match. The last Liverpool player to achieve this feat was Michael Owen in 2001 (Owen scored seven times in the final 4 League fixtures of 2000-2001 and twice in the opening League match of 2001-2002).

    - Maxi Rodriguez scores his second hat-trick in three Premier League matches.

Other details

Manager: Kenny Dalglish
Opposition manager: Mark Hughes
Referee: Mason LS
Attendance: 25,693
Half-time score: 0 - 3
Game number: 5258
League game number: 4256
Liverpool league position: 5th
Fulham league position: 10th
